According to a Nielsen study, Yelp isn’t too bad at driving sales either – 4 out of 5 Yelp users stated that they visit Yelp when prepared to spend money and 35% of Yelp users will visit a searched business within 24 hours of searching. With 142 million unique users per month, Yelp is one of the hottest marketing spaces online, competing with the likes of Google and Facebook.
